Polure pilaster
Polure pilaster refers to the polyurethane pilaster products manufactured by Polure. A pilaster is a decorative element shaped like a half-column embedded in the wall; its shaft can be plain or fluted and is used together with a base below and a capital above. It is used on interior and exterior facades beside doors and windows, at corners and in wall divisions as a vertical accent element. Polyurethane is lightweight; it is applied directly to the wall with mounting adhesive, resists moisture and impact, will not crack or blister, and can be painted. Being far lighter than a stone or plaster pilaster, it can be carried and mounted by one person and adds no extra load to the wall. Because Polure produces the shaft, base and capital from a mould, the parts match in compatible dimensions.
